Suction Power: What You Need to Know
Suction power is often quantified in Pascals (Pa), which measures the force at which air and particles are drawn into the vacuum. Various models feature different levels of suction intensity:
- Standard Models: These typically offer lower suction capabilities suitable for light cleaning tasks.
- Mid-range Options: A balanced choice that provides adequate power for everyday messes without being overly aggressive.
- High-performance Units: Designed for deep cleaning, these vacuums deliver superior suction strength ideal for households with pets or heavy foot traffic.
Understanding these categories allows us to align our expectations with specific needs-if pet hair removal is a priority, opting for a model with high suction capability becomes imperative.

Runtime vs. Charging Time
One key aspect to consider is the balance between runtime and charging time:
- Typical Runtime: Most modern hr101 robot vacuums offer runtimes ranging from 60 to 120 minutes on a single charge, allowing them to cover substantial areas in one go.
- Charging Duration: While some models may provide extended runtimes, they might require longer charging periods-often upwards of 4 hours. We should look for options that minimize downtime while maximizing cleaning efficiency.
Battery Technology
The type of battery used in the hr101 robot vacuum cleaner plays an essential role in performance:
- Lithium-ion Batteries: These are commonly found in higher-end models due to their lightweight nature and ability to retain charge over time without significant loss.
- Nickel-Cadmium Batteries: While generally less expensive, these batteries can suffer from memory effects, which may reduce overall longevity and runtime.
By paying attention to the type of battery technology employed, we can select a model that aligns with our expectations for both durability and performance.

Noise Levels
Noise levels play a significant role in determining how disruptive a robot vacuum might be during operation. Here are key points to evaluate:
- Decibel Rating: Most manufacturers provide a decibel rating for their devices. For context:
- A quiet model operates at around 60 dB (similar to normal conversation).
- Standard vacuums may range from 70 dB upwards (equivalent to heavy traffic).
Understanding these ratings helps us select a model that minimizes disturbances during cleaning sessions.
- Cleaning Modes: Certain hr101 robot vacuums feature different cleaning modes that adjust performance based on need. For example:
- Eco mode often reduces suction power, resulting in quieter operation.
- Turbo mode maximizes suction for deep cleaning but may increase noise levels.
